WW1 British War medal & Victory medal Lieut D L Moore Douglas Lewis Moore was KIA 22/4/1918 age 19 while serving in the 1st Bn Somerset Light Infantry The 1st Bn Somerset Light Infantry had 66 men & 3 Officers as fatal casualties between 14/4/18 - 22/4/18 others KIA 22/4/1918 3/7451 Cpl W Axe,28140 Pte W H Beale,204775 Pte A Dewar,32378.Pte E G Ralph,40691 Pte R J Ward. Douglas Lewis Moore was the son of Lewis Moore The manager of a Jewellery shop. The family are on the 1911 census .69 Telford Ave,Streatham ,Douglas is age 12 He was educated at Battersea Grammer School He went to France 11/12/1917 as a 2nd Lieut joined 1st Bn as a Lieut 16/2/1918 KIA 22/4/1918 medals in very good condition (EF ) mounted for display on original silk ribbons.
